TIBALLI, Elianda Figueiredo Arantes. The duality of the brazilian school in the first half of the 20th century: records of INEP. Cad. Hist. Educ. [online]. 2016, vol.15, n.3, pp.1101-1117. ISSN 1982-7806.  https://doi.org/10.14393/che-v15n3-2016-10.

This paper aims at discussing the explanations about the dual education system, formulated by the INEP´s intellectuals/ researchers in the early 20th century. For this purpose, twenty-five academic articles, published between 1944 and 1964, in the Brazilian Journal of Pedagogical Studies (Revista Brasileira de Estudos Pedagógicos - RBEP), were analyzed and identified by the keyword ‘quality of teaching’. The Wolff Lepenies´s theoretical and methodological reference was used for the intellectual history, considering the historical, the institutional and the cognitive contexts of the educational discourse published in the RBEP in this period. The results show that it was possible to identify, in the collected data, the historical persistence of educational inequalities and the dual education system in Brazil since the origin of the Brazilian public school.

Keywords : INEP (1944/1964); Duality of School; Intellectual History.
